    Bratislava, one of the hotbeds for Season 37 VHL prospects, was visited by VHL scouts this past week to interview players.  
     
    "It's always good to get a sense of the personalities behind the players.  You never want to draft someone who will be a burden to your franchise.  The top drafting teams need players who are willing to help steer the ship around and stick around longer than a couple of seasons.  There's a lot of depth in this draft and it should be one of the better ones in a while." - Unnamed Scout.
     
    So far the Wranglers, Reign, Bears and Express are the bottom four teams in the league.  However, not all the teams in the bottom four hold their original draft picks.  If the draft were to happen today (without the lottery), the order would be:
     
    New York 
    Riga
    Calgary
    Cologne
     
    It will be interesting to see how the rest of the season plays out and how the draft unfolds.  Watchmen teammates Tom Slaughter and Slaeter Fjorsstrom will more than likely go 1 and 2, but the order depends on what each team drafting in the top two needs.

    #175 The Super Draft
     
    The race to the post-season is in full swing with most of the league still in the hunt for a Continental Cup.  That doesn’t mean its too early to talk about the draft though.  The Season 36 Draft ended up being quite amazing for high end talent with decent depth.  The Season 37 Draft is shaping to be not quite as top heavy but even deeper than the draft we had last season.  A ton of former player agents have sprinkled new players back into the league in recent days and weeks.  The crop of first generational talent though is quite remarkable with the recruitment efforts the league has had lately.
     
    We can’t yet put the “Super Draft” label on this class but I wanted to talk about dealing with a better draft and the pressure behind it.  Every draft must be scouted in depth especially if you have a number of picks.  When the draft is weaker you already kind of know what you are getting.  The chance for late round steals become harder and the late first round talent often bust too.  When there is talent at every corner though and everyone seems to be destined for the VHL things are actually much tougher.
     
    When expectations are low there is no pressure.  In a super draft you know any pick could turn into the next Hall of Famer.  There will be a range of six to eight players that look identical going into the draft.  A bunch of them will fizzle out and never make it even out of the minors.  The rest though will go on to become the next generation of VHL superstars.  The pressure on a GM to figure out which of the many rising VHLM stars will be able to take the next step is enormous.  The fate of the franchise can rest with the picks in a great draft and you don’t want to be the only one that misses out.
     
    A GM can live with a bad trade, he can learn from it, and take accept a bleak future if it means winning now.  A GM cannot sleep over the picks he missed in the draft.  Knowing that for the simple act of calling out a name he could have the next Scotty Campbell is enough to drive you crazy.  If you don’t do the research of every nook and cranny to find the truth when a prospect says yes I’ll make it someday you won’t forgive yourself.  The realization a season later when you passed on the Rookie of the Year for a no name minor league scrub is what the “Super Draft” is all about.

    175: Devising Drama

    An exciting and unpredictable season has brought about what is looking like an interesting run-up to probably next Monday's (February 3rd) trade deadline. This past week has seen a flurry of various transactions and different types of activity and one man has been at the centre of a few events: Devise22.

    I don't particularly want to dedicate an article to Devise immediately after his piss-poor treatment of the Keiji Toriyama to Vasteras trade but you can't ignore the fact that the 3-paragraph man knows how to get VHL drama going, even if often involuntarily. Before he engulfed in the distasteful argument over the short- and long-term strategy of Corco and the Vasteras Iron Eagles, an even more intriguing event transpired: Skylar Rift retired. It came out of the blue for many members and though I knew that Rift would likely not play out his maximum possible career, I still felt Devise would give him more time given that Rift's career looks from the outside to be about as fun as it is physically possible for a goalie. Instead, Rift will retire having appeared in just five VHL seasons and most surprisingly of all for me, he opted to retire long enough before the trade deadline to not be eligible to be in the S38 draft and give his new player more time to develop.

    Up until Rift's retirement, the trade market had gone a bit stale. I don't think we should credit the subsequent trades involving Vasteras, New York, Cologne, and Seattle to the retirement but it has definitely opened up a wide range of opportunities. The off-season is now quite a bit of an unknown and that should bode for some good activity, in a trade sense and a forum sense. Will Quebec sell? Will Quebec buy from Helsinki or Cologne or both? Will they have to overpay? Who else will opt to sell or buy now that there might actually be buyers? Lots of questions and few answers which is always good for league activity.

    There was a very brief discussion in the Board of Governors recently about the vast majority of actives now playing out full eight seasons as opposed to six which was the norm up to around Season 20. Devise has gone against the flow with Rift and that's a positive, since when things follow the same blueprint (not that I'm against full eight-season careers), a bit of change always raises eyebrows and creates discussion. In five seasons, Rift played for three teams, the change from Calgary to Quebec being the most infamous and again different, and never shied away from speaking his mind when most went on with their business. So credit where credit is due to Devise even though he can come across as a bit of a dick, especially to those who don't really know him, more often than not.
